57/**
58 * OpenGL renderer used to draw accelerated 2D graphics. The API is a
59 * simplified version of Skia's Canvas API.
60 */
61class OpenGLRenderer {
62public:
63    OpenGLRenderer();
64    ~OpenGLRenderer();
65
66    void setViewport(int width, int height);
67    void prepare();
68
69    int getSaveCount() const;
70    int save(int flags);
71    void restore();
72    void restoreToCount(int saveCount);
73
74    int saveLayer(float left, float top, float right, float bottom, const SkPaint* p, int flags);
75    int saveLayerAlpha(float left, float top, float right, float bottom, int alpha, int flags);
76
77    void translate(float dx, float dy);
78    void rotate(float degrees);
79    void scale(float sx, float sy);
80
81    void setMatrix(SkMatrix* matrix);
82    void getMatrix(SkMatrix* matrix);
83    void concatMatrix(SkMatrix* matrix);
84
85    const Rect& getClipBounds();
86    bool quickReject(float left, float top, float right, float bottom);
87    bool clipRect(float left, float top, float right, float bottom, SkRegion::Op op);
88
89    void drawBitmap(SkBitmap* bitmap, float left, float top, const SkPaint* paint);
90    void drawBitmap(SkBitmap* bitmap, const SkMatrix* matrix, const SkPaint* paint);
91    void drawBitmap(SkBitmap* bitmap, float srcLeft, float srcTop, float srcRight, float srcBottom,
92            float dstLeft, float dstTop, float dstRight, float dstBottom, const SkPaint* paint);
93    void drawPatch(SkBitmap* bitmap, Res_png_9patch* patch, float left, float top,
94            float right, float bottom, const SkPaint* paint);
95    void drawColor(int color, SkXfermode::Mode mode);
96    void drawRect(float left, float top, float right, float bottom, const SkPaint* paint);
97    void drawPath(SkPath* path, SkPaint* paint);
98
99    void resetShader();
100    void setupShader(SkiaShader* shader);
101
102    void resetColorFilter();
103    void setupColorFilter(SkiaColorFilter* filter);
104
105    void resetShadow();
106    void setupShadow(float radius, float dx, float dy, int color);
107
108    void drawText(const char* text, int bytesCount, int count, float x, float y, SkPaint* paint);

110private:
111    /**
112     * Saves the current state of the renderer as a new snapshot.
113     * The new snapshot is saved in mSnapshot and the previous snapshot
114     * is linked from mSnapshot->previous.
115     *
116     * @return The new save count. This value can be passed to #restoreToCount()
117     */
118    int saveSnapshot();
119
120    /**
121     * Restores the current snapshot; mSnapshot becomes mSnapshot->previous.
122     *
123     * @return True if the clip should be also reapplied by calling
124     *         #setScissorFromClip().
125     */
126    bool restoreSnapshot();
127
128    /**
129     * Sets the clipping rectangle using glScissor. The clip is defined by
130     * the current snapshot's clipRect member.
131     */
132    void setScissorFromClip();
133
134    /**
135     * Compose the layer defined in the current snapshot with the layer
136     * defined by the previous snapshot.
137     *
138     * The current snapshot *must* be a layer (flag kFlagIsLayer set.)
139     *
140     * @param curent The current snapshot containing the layer to compose
141     * @param previous The previous snapshot to compose the current layer with
142     */
143    void composeLayer(sp<Snapshot> current, sp<Snapshot> previous);
